Summary

  • Training and Experience: I am currently a clinical fellow in cardiovascular disease, pursuing competency in echocardiography, nuclear cardiology, and coronary CT angiography.

    Clinical and Research Interests: Advanced cardiac imaging; metabolic mechanisms of myocardial dysfunction; impact of lifestyle, fitness, and obesity on cardiovascular risk.
